Subject: [PATCH] drm/sun4i: hdmi ddc clk: Fix size of m divider
Date: Mon, 13 Apr 2020 11:54:57 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20200413095457.1176754-1-jernej.skrabec@siol.net> (raw)
m divider in DDC clock register is 4 bits wide. Fix that.
Fixes: 9c5681011a0c ("drm/sun4i: Add HDMI support")
Signed-off-by: Jernej Skrabec <jernej.skrabec@siol.net>
---
drivers/gpu/drm/sun4i/sun4i_hdmi.h | 2 +-
drivers/gpu/drm/sun4i/sun4i_hdmi_ddc_clk.c | 2 +-
2 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/sun4i/sun4i_hdmi.h b/drivers/gpu/drm/sun4i/sun4i_hdmi.h
index 7ad3f06c127e..00ca35f07ba5 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/sun4i/sun4i_hdmi.h
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/sun4i/sun4i_hdmi.h
@@ -148,7 +148,7 @@
#define SUN4I_HDMI_DDC_CMD_IMPLICIT_WRITE 3
#define SUN4I_HDMI_DDC_CLK_REG 0x528
-#define SUN4I_HDMI_DDC_CLK_M(m) (((m) & 0x7) << 3)
+#define SUN4I_HDMI_DDC_CLK_M(m) (((m) & 0xf) << 3)
#define SUN4I_HDMI_DDC_CLK_N(n) ((n) & 0x7)
#define SUN4I_HDMI_DDC_LINE_CTRL_REG 0x540
di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/sun4i/sun4i_hdmi_ddc_clk.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/sun4i/sun4i_hdmi_ddc_clk.c
index 2ff780114106..12430b9d4e93 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/sun4i/sun4i_hdmi_ddc_clk.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/sun4i/sun4i_hdmi_ddc_clk.c
@@ -33,7 +33,7 @@ static unsigned long sun4i_ddc_calc_divider(unsigned long rate,
unsigned long best_rate = 0;
u8 best_m = 0, best_n = 0, _m, _n;
- for (_m = 0; _m < 8; _m++) {
+ for (_m = 0; _m < 16; _m++) {
for (_n = 0; _n < 8; _n++) {
unsigned long tmp_rate;
